Spring Repair: What to Expect During Service

When a garage door spring breaks, it is rarely a subtle event. You likely heard a loud bang resembling a gunshot or a firecracker coming from the garage. This noise occurs because the potential energy stored in the tightly wound coils is suddenly released. Once this happens, the counterbalance system fails, and the door feels incredibly heavy, often weighing upwards of 200 to 300 pounds. Attempting to use the automatic opener in this state can strip its gears or burn out the motor, leading to more expensive repairs.

Upon arrival, a technician performs a 25-point safety inspection. This is not just to look at the broken spring, but to determine if the sudden snap caused collateral damage to cables, drums, or rollers.

Here is what generally happens during a service visit:

  • System Diagnosis: The technician identifies whether you have a torsion spring system (mounted above the door) or an extension spring system (mounted along the sides).
  • Weight Assessment: We weigh the door to ensure the replacement springs match the specific lift requirements. Installing the wrong size can cause the door to bounce or crash.
  • Inventory Availability: Technicians carry commonly used spring sizes and components, allowing many repairs to be completed during the visit when appropriate parts are available.
  • Safety Containment: If the door is stuck in a partially open position, we secure it to prevent falling before any work begins.

The Torsion and Extension Spring Replacement Process

Repairing a garage door spring is technically a replacement process. Springs cannot be welded or put back together once the metal has fatigued and separated. The replacement procedure is precise and involves handling high-tension components that can be dangerous if mishandled. Understanding the steps involved helps illustrate why this is a job for equipped professionals rather than a DIY project.

Preparing the Door and Workspace

The workspace must be cleared to allow for safe ladder placement and tool access. The process begins by disconnecting the electric garage door opener to prevent accidental activation. This ensures that the drive mechanism is disengaged, allowing the technician to manipulate the door manually. Clamps are applied to the track just above the rollers to lock the door in the down position. This is critical because the springs provide lift. If they are manipulated while the door is unsecured, the door could move unexpectedly.

Unwinding and Removal

For torsion spring systems, the intact spring (if there are two) must be carefully unwound. Even though one spring is broken, the other still holds significant tension.

  • Technicians use hardened steel winding bars that fit precisely into the winding cone.
  • The tension is released in quarter-turn increments.
  • Great care is taken to keep the body positioned away from the cone of danger in case a winding bar slips.
  • Once all tension is removed, the center bearing plate and cable drums are loosened, allowing the old springs to be slid off the torsion tube.

Installation of New Coils

The new springs are selected based on the door’s weight and track radius. We slide the new springs onto the torsion tube, replacing the center bearing if it shows signs of wear. The cable drums are re-secured, ensuring the lift cables have equal tension on both sides. Uneven cables can cause the door to rack or jam in the tracks.

Winding and Balancing

This is the most physically demanding part of the repair. The new springs must be wound to a specific number of turns calculated based on the height of the door.

  • The technician uses winding bars to tighten the spring, adding tension.
  • Once the calculated turns are achieved, the set screws are tightened to lock the spring to the shaft.
  • The technician then tests the balance of the door. A properly balanced door should stay in place when lifted halfway up manually. It should not move rapidly upward or drift downward.
  • Adjustments are made in small increments until the balance is correct.

Deciding Between Spring Repair and Complete Replacement

Homeowners often ask if they can just replace the one broken spring or if they need to overhaul the entire system. While the immediate goal is to address the break, looking at the broader health of the garage door system is financially prudent.

The Both Springs Rule

Most standard garage doors utilize two springs to share the weight. These springs are installed at the same time and undergo the same number of open and close cycles. If one spring breaks, the second spring is likely near the end of its lifespan as well. Replacing only one spring creates an imbalance because the new spring is tight and fresh, while the old one is stretched and fatigued.

  • Replacing both springs ensures the door lifts evenly.
  • It helps avoid an additional service visit if the second spring fails later.
  • It provides a unified warranty start date for the hardware.

High-Cycle vs. Standard-Cycle Springs

When selecting a replacement, you have options regarding durability. Standard springs are typically rated for 10,000 cycles. For an active household using the door frequently, this may last only a few years.

  • Standard Cycle: Best for homeowners planning to move soon or for garages that are used less frequently.
  • High-Cycle Options: These springs are larger and engineered to last 25,000 to 50,000 cycles. They cost more upfront but can extend the time between replacements.
  • Powder Coated vs. Oil Tempered: We help you decide between corrosion-resistant coated springs, which are cleaner and rust-resistant, and oil-tempered springs, which are durable and self-lubricating but may leave residue.

Assessing the Opener and Hardware

Sometimes a spring break is forceful enough to damage the electric opener. If the gear sprocket inside the opener is stripped, or if the trolley arm is bent, we may recommend addressing those components at the same time. If your door system is over 15 years old, uninsulated, and showing track or panel wear, it may be worth discussing long-term options rather than continuing to repair aging components.

Why Professional Spring Service Ensures Long-Term Safety

Garage door spring replacement is consistently ranked as one of the most dangerous home repairs for untrained individuals. The amount of torque required to lift a heavy garage door is stored entirely within the springs. Improper tools or techniques can lead to serious injury.

Beyond the immediate physical risk, improper installation can shorten the lifespan of other components.

  • Opener Preservation: The electric opener is designed to move a balanced door. If the springs are not calibrated correctly, excessive strain can damage internal gears and motors.
  • Structural Integrity: An unbalanced door places uneven pressure on tracks and rollers, which can lead to misalignment or component failure over time.
